Mysql
 sql >> Cơ Sở Dữ Liệu >  >> RDS >> Mysql

Làm cách nào để coi NULL là ngày MAX thay vì bỏ qua nó trong MySQL?

Hãy thử cái này:

SELECT ID, case when MAX(DATE IS NULL) = 0 THEN max(DATE) END AS DATE
FROM test
GROUP BY ID;


  1. Database
  2.   
  3. Mysql
  4.   
  5. Oracle
  6.   
  7. Sqlserver
  8.   
  9. PostgreSQL
  10.   
  11. Access
  12.   
  13. SQLite
  14.   
  15. MariaDB
  1. Mysql tạo một thủ tục được lưu trữ từ nhiều thủ tục được lưu trữ

  2. codeigniter - cơ sở dữ liệu:cách cập nhật nhiều bảng với một truy vấn cập nhật duy nhất

  3. Hàm MySQL SIGN () - Tìm hiểu xem một số là dương hay âm trong MySQL

  4. Kiểm tra kết nối cơ sở dữ liệu Entity Framework

  5. Ghi nhật ký tất cả các truy vấn trong mysql